      Maine Pretrial Services/ Kennebec County/Cumberland CountyJusticePretrial services program can be valuable resources for making significant improvements in the criminal justice system because they are used in the early stages of the criminal case process. Unnecessary detention before trial not only results in unnecessary jail costs, it also deprives defendants of their liberty. From a policy perspective, decisions about detaining or releasing defendants should balance the benefits of release and the risk of flight or threat to public safety.I am doing a lot of interesting work here at Maine Pretrial.
